Comprehensive Appliance Repair Services in Greenwood
Refrigerator Repair: Compressors often fail more often in Greenwood's humid summers. Your refrigerator works overtime when outdoor temperatures hit 85°F and indoor humidity reaches 70%. EPA608-certified service professionals diagnose compressor issues, condenser coil scaling from hard water, and control board failures from power surges with expert refrigerator repairs.
- Washer Repair: Front-load washers develop mold in door seals because the humidity prevents moisture from evaporating. Clay soil shifts throw machines out of level, stressing the transmission and causing leaks. Our service professionals can repair pumps, belts, and control boards.
- Dryer Repair: Gas and electric dryers both fail in winter when the 20°F cold freezes the vents solid. Gas igniters crack from thermal stress. Electric heating elements corrode from hard-water humidity. Our service professional clears vent blockages, replaces igniters rated for temperature swings, and tests airflow during our dryer repair.
- Dishwasher Repair: Greenwood's 200 mg/L average water hardness clogs spray arms and coats heating elements within months. Bosch, Asko, and other European brands suffer the worst because they're designed for softer water. Our dishwasher repair professional descales pumps, replaces clogged filters, and installs inline water treatment when needed.
- Oven and Range Repair: Induction, gas, and electric ranges all face challenges, but we can help with our oven, stove and range repair. Gas igniters crack in winter. Electric elements scale with humidity. Induction control boards fry during power surges. We have experience with Thermador and Gaggenau units, common in local neighborhoods, that require factory parts and specialized calibration to be properly repaired.
- Ice Maker Repair: Scale buildup jams fill valves within six months in Greenwood homes. High-end Sub-Zero and Marvel ice makers require EPA608-certified refrigerant work. Our service professional can help replace valves, descale lines, and test water pressure.
- Built-In Appliance Repair: Wall ovens and cooktops in Valley Brook Farms and Wood Ridge homes shift when foundations settle. Door seals break, elements misalign, and control panels crack. Your service professional releases units, replaces damaged components, and modifies installations.
